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Cook barley in a largepot of boiling salted water until tender,15–20 minutes for pearl, 35–40 for hulled orhull-less.
  2. Drain and spread out on a rimmedbaking sheet; let cool.
  3. Meanwhile, toss breadcrumbs with1 tablespoon oil on another rimmed baking sheet;season with salt.
  4. Bake, tossing once, untilgolden brown, 10–12 minutes; let cool.
  5. Bring milk to a simmer in a mediumsaucepan over medium-high heat; seasonwith salt.
  6. Add cauliflower and cook untiljust softened, about 3 minutes; drain well.Discard milk.
  7. Toss cauliflower, barley, breadcrumbs,shallot, celery hearts, celery leaves,parsley, parsley stems, lemon zest, lemonjuice, and vinegar in a bowl; season saladwith salt.
  8. Mix burrata and crème fraîche in amedium bowl; season with salt. Divideburrata mixture among plates, drizzle withoil, and top with barley salad; season withpepper.
  9. DO AHEAD: Barley can be cooked 1 dayahead; cover and chill. Breadcrumbscan be toasted 1 day ahead; store airtightat room temperature.
